Creating a LiDAR Dataset for Self-Driving Technology – Center for Data Innovation

Volvo has created Cirrus, a dataset of LiDAR vehicle scanning patterns (laser technology that uses light to measure distances between cars), corresponding camera images, and annotations, to help advance research and development of algorithms for safe self-driving technology. Cirrus includes 6,285 pairs of scanning patterns and camera images annotated along eight object categories, including categories such as large vehicle, pedestrian, bicycle, and animal.
